1155
CS/CJ/NSJ Series Instructions Reference Manual (W474)
4. Instruction Execution Times and Number of Steps
4-1 CJ2 CPU Unit Instruction Execution Times and Number of Steps
4
4-1-11 Logic Instructions
4-1-11 Logic Instructions
GRAY CODE CONVERSION GRY 4 26.5 49.1 8-bit binary
27.6 51.1 8-bit BCD
30.9 57.2 8-bit angle
35.3 66.0 15-bit binary
36.3 68.0 15-bit BCD
39.6 74.0 15-bit angle
GRAY CODE TO BINARY
CONVERT
GRAY_BIN 3 0.1 0.3 ---
DOUBLE GRAY CODE TO
BINARY CONVERT
GRAY_BINL 3 to 4 0.1 0.4 ---
DOUBLE GRAY CODE TO
BINARY CONVERT
BIN_GRAY 3 0.1 0.3 ---
DOUBLE BINARY TO GRAY
CODE CONVERT
BIN_GRAYL 3 to 4 0.1 0.4 ---
FOUR-DIGIT NUMBER TO
ASCII
STR4 3 8.4 14.2 ---
EIGHT-DIGIT NUMBER TO
ASCII
STR8 3 to 4 10.2 16.4 ---
SIXTEEN-DIGIT NUMBER
TO ASCII
STR16 3 15.8 28.2 ---
ASCII TO FOUR-DIGIT NUM-
BER
NUM4 3 to 4 10.5 18.5 ---
ASCII TO EIGHT-DIGIT NUM-
BER
NUM8 3 14.8 27.1 ---
ASCII TO SIXTEEN-DIGIT
NUMBER
NUM16 3 27.4 52.0 ---
Instruction Mnemonic Length
(steps)
ON execution time (µs) Conditions
CJ2H
CPU6@(-EIP)
CJ2M CPU@@
LOGICAL AND ANDW 4 0.14 0.340 ---
DOUBLE LOGICAL AND ANDL 4 to 6 0.26 0.640 ---
LOGICAL OR ORW 4 0.18 0.340 ---
DOUBLE LOGICAL OR ORWL 4 to 6 0.26 0.640 ---
EXCLUSIVE OR XORW 4 0.18 0.340 ---
DOUBLE EXCLUSIVE OR XORL 4 to 6 0.26 0.640 ---
EXCLUSIVE NOR XNRW 4 0.18 0.340 ---
DOUBLE EXCLUSIVE NOR XNRL 4 to 6 0.26 0.640 ---
COMPLEMENT COM 2 0.18 0.240 ---
DOUBLE COMPLEMENT COML 2 0.32 0.440 ---
Instruction Mnemonic Length
(steps)
ON execution time (µs) Conditions
CJ2H
CPU6@(-EIP)
CJ2M CPU@@